The refined woman found a new wardrobe staple when Frederic Boucheron launched his eponymous brand in 1858. A century and a half later, it’s almost ritualistic for today’s modern woman to don the precious stones of a line that won European royalty and Maharajahs over. Imagine wearing a bracelet formed with pairs of lapis lazuli cabochons and frosted crystal beads with gold mounts for a sense of prestige personified.
